People suffer as 3 water reservoirs await inauguration in Ganderbal

People suffer as 3 water reservoirs await inauguration in Ganderbal

Ganderbal : Establishment of three filtration reservoirs for provision of clean drinking water to three areas in Beehama, Repora and Arhama is still awaiting inauguration, affecting residents. The three water reservoirs were constructed by the public health engineering (PHE) department at a total cost of more than Rs 10 crores to resolve shortage of water […]
